Assessment and Inspection
Our technicians start by checking the full extent of the damage. We use moisture meters and thermal imaging to find hidden water. This step is crucial because it tells us where the water is and how deep it’s gone. You don’t have to guess, our team gives you a clear picture of what’s happening. Water Extraction
We use powerful pumps and extractors to remove standing water quickly. This step can take 1-3 hours depending on the size of the area. Time is on our side here. Drying and Dehumidification
After the water is gone, we set up industrial dryers and dehumidifiers. This process can take 3-5 days. We monitor the area constantly to make sure everything dries properly. Warning Signs You Need Corroded Pipe Water Removal
Ignoring early signs of corroded pipes can cost you more in the long run. The longer you wait, the more damage can happen. You might not notice the problem at first, but there are clear indicators that something is wrong. Catching these signs early means faster repairs and less stress.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
A musty smell in your home isn’t just unpleasant, it’s a sign of hidden moisture. Corroded pipes can leave water behind that leads to mold. This smell lingers even after you clean and air out your home. You’re not imagining it. The problem is real and needs attention. Mold can cause health issues and make your home unsafe.
Low Water Pressure or Discolored Water
If your water pressure drops or the water looks brown or yellow, it’s a red flag. Corroded pipes can leak into your water supply. This affects your daily routine and can make the water unsafe. You don’t want to drink or use water that’s contaminated. Fixing this issue early prevents more serious problems down the line.
Visible Leaks or Water Puddles
Leaking pipes can cause puddles on the floor or damp spots on walls. These signs are easy to spot, but they can lead to bigger issues if ignored. Water can seep into structural parts of your home and cause long-term damage. You don’t have to wait for the damage to get worse. Taking action now can save you money and stress later.
Increased Water Bills
If your water bill jumps without a clear reason, it might be a sign of a hidden leak. Corroded pipes can let water escape without you noticing. This means you’re paying for water you’re not using. It’s a waste of money and a sign of a problem that needs fixing. Checking for leaks can help you save money and prevent more damage.
Cracked or Warped Flooring
Water from corroded pipes can damage your floors. Cracks, warping, or soft spots are clear signs. This affects the structure of your home and can lead to more expensive repairs. You can’t ignore this. Fixing it early can prevent more serious issues and keep your home safe and comfortable.
Unexplained Mold Growth
Mold can appear in areas where water has been present. If you see mold in places that don’t get much moisture, it’s a sign of hidden water. Corroded pipes can leave moisture behind that’s hard to spot. Mold is a health risk and can spread quickly. You need to act fast to prevent it from getting worse.

Corroded Pipe Water Removal Cost In Massanutten, VA
Costs for corroded pipe water removal vary based on the severity of the damage and the size of the area affected. You might see prices range from $500 to $2,500 depending on the situation. These are estimates and not guarantees. Every home is different, and the right solution will depend on your specific needs. You’ll get a clear breakdown of what to expect.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Initial inspection and assessment | $150 – $350 | Size of the area, complexity of the damage, and number of affected systems. |
| Water extraction | $200 – $600 | Amount of water removed and time required to complete the job. |
| Drying and dehumidification | $400 – $1,200 | Duration of the drying process and number of drying units used. |
| Sanitization and mold remediation | $300 – $900 | Extent of mold growth and areas affected by moisture. |
| Repairs and restoration | $500 – $2,500 | Materials needed and complexity of the repairs. |
| Emergency response | $100 – $300 | Time of day and urgency of the call. |
